Solid sorbents that can selectively capture CO2 are a preferable alternative to surpass the limitations of scrubbing liquid amine technology.

Mesoporous silicas functionalised with primary and tertiary amines were prepared and dosed with 13CO2 under dry and wet conditions and the structure of CO2 species formed was monitored by ssNMR.
